First stop is Chinatown! On Sunday go to this little place called: Shanghai Asian Manor (21 Mott Street, New York, NY 10013) We had many things but my favourites were the steamed buns, the fried jumbo shrimp w.fruit sauce and the sliced chicken w broccoli(this I'm not sure if that's what it's called but it is the picture in the menu and is fried and amazing!!!!We had a lot of food and it was super cheap!

Next stop: Little Italy!! Go and buy small cannolis! Best thing ever and soo cheap!

If you are in the mood of Pizza and a movie go to Two Brothers Pizza. I swear is the best pizza I have had in my entire life(well not true, my nanny makes the best pizza). The size is perfect and all the ingredients are fresh and soft and delicious!
